Council reshuffles committee assignments, drops regular library liaison role
Summary
Council approved changes to regional-board and committee assignments: Kevin Burke will take the Ranch assignment, Pat will serve as alternate on the Marin Bay Wave sea-level-rise committee, and the council agreed to stop maintaining a regular council liaison to the Belvedere-Tiburon Library Agency in favor of having trustees report to council annually.

The council approved changes to regional-board and committee assignments at the Dec. 8 meeting. Council member Kevin Burke agreed to take on the Ranch assignment; Pat agreed to serve as an alternate on the Marin Bay Wave sea-level-rise committee. Council also discussed whether the city should keep a council liaison to the Belvedere-Tiburon Library Agency and concluded staff should explore asking appointed trustees to provide an annual report to council rather than requiring a council member to attend every library-trustee meeting.
Council requested staff (Beth) draft changes to committee descriptions so that Tiburon Peninsula and Belvedere committees report to the city council at least once a year. The motion to approve the committee assignments passed by voice vote.
